FRED  - January 21, 2006 - January 3, 2019

On Thursday, January 3, 2019 at 3:30PM EST, Fred Bob Bittner, faithful, fun loving, adventurous companion passed away a couple weeks before turning 13. Fred was born on January 21, 2006 in La Pine, OR and “adopted” by Andy and Melody Bittner 8 weeks later. Andy discovered him in a box of puppies being given away in front of Thriftway by a couple teen age kids. Andy was told the puppies were half lab, quarter pit and quarter golden retriever, a mix for which he had been looking. He left and called Melody leaving a voicemail telling her she would be proud of him for not getting a dog. He then changed his mind went back and got the puppy. Next thing Melody knows is she gets a picture on her phone introducing Fred. Over the years Fred loved playing with sticks, swimming, boating, running and exploring our great country. While living in La Pine he learned all sorts of things and especially enjoyed running -a lot- including in the snow. One of his favorite games as a puppy was running the fence line with the Shelties next door or taking off and letting Andy follow him for multiple miles until Fred decided it was time to go home. After moving to Portland, Fred became a beloved Deli Dog, greeting customers at the Piedmont Deli. There he met many new friends including the owner of the bar next door. She befriended him and one morning came and asked if Fred could come over and play. He ended up spending a few hours each day helping to clean up the bar, picking up tater tots and receipts from the floor and bringing them to the bar owner. She even invited him to her birthday party! Moving to Flint, MI began his cross country adventures. Over the next couple of years Fred visited all of the lower 48 states multiple times. He loved to swim and over the years had the privilege of swimming in the Pacific, Atlantic, multiple Great Lakes, the Columbia and Mississippi Rivers, the Gulf of Mexico and many smaller bodies of water including American Lake in Washington and Johnson Creek in his back yard in Gresham, OR. Upon moving back to the Portland area he became a greeter and undercover drug sniffing dog at Mail Room Plus in both Portland and Vancouver. In 2018 he again enjoyed traveling in Oregon, Washington and California prior to his final cross country trip and retirement in North Carolina. He is survived by his “parents” Andy and Melody and his “brother” Buddy.
